Frequently asked questions

What makes a good business name?
Short, easy to say and spell, distinctive enough to own, and free where it counts: the .com and your main social handles. This tool scores names for length and pronounceability, then checks availability so you are not left in love with a name you cannot use.
Should I prioritise the .com?
For most businesses, yes. A .com is still what people type and trust by default. If your .com is taken, a short .co or a clean .io can work, especially for tech and online brands, and the tool checks all of them at once.
